What happens when we juxtapose medicine and law in the ancient Roman world? This innovative collection of scholarly research shows how both fields were shaped by the particular needs and desires of their practitioners and users. Through case studies in both fields and on each of these topics, together with contextualizing essays, this book suggests that the blanket results of all this were profound.
